"The four corners of the earth" is a >> phrase that can be found in their book. From that to "of the globe" is >> a short step. > > I don't think we can blame the Bible for this. While there have been > educated people who understood our planet to be spheroid since before the > common era, the Bible is mostly written by communities that shared the > ancient cosmology of a flat earth capped by an overarching canopy of stars > and planets. The Hebrew word "kanaph" (see Isaiah 11:12) and the greek word > "gonia" (see Revelation 7:1) can mean something like "section" or "quadrant" > but are most often best translated as "corner" (this whole subject is the > center of pretty intense argument among the fundamentalists, many of whom > want to say that the Bible, since it can never be "wrong" in any way, never > implies that the earth is flat). > > I wouldn't blame the Bible for using the construction "four corners of the > earth" - but once the idea of a roundish earth is internalized (signaled by > the use of the word "globe") then I think we have entered the realm of the > self-contradictory.
